Hustle bustle in markets as shoppers make last-minute purchases ahead of Eid | KNO

Srinagar, Mar 29 (KNO): As Eid-ul-Fitr is nearing, the markets in Kashmir are full of shoppers with roads filled with people and a celebratory mood surrounding the atmosphere. From shopping outlets to bakery stores, the business is picking up as people shop for the last time to welcome the celebratory occasion. As per the information available with the news agency—Kashmir News Observer (KNO), Srinagar's Lal Chowk, Polo View, and Residency Road and other markets are experiencing crowded buyers, with customers grabbing clothing, shoes, and sweets. Henna, bangles, and decorative vendors have pitched their stalls, further enhancing the festive fervour. Amina, a customer at Lal Chowk Srinagar said, Eid is not complete without shopping and children’s gifts. “We have been shopping for the last few days, but the actual rush is witnessed in the last hour,” she added. Likewise, sweet and bakery shops also have an excessive response, and individuals are purchasing special delicacies for the same. “Eid is about traditional sweets here. Bakery goods demand has surged,” Bashir Ahmad, an owner of a bakery shop in Srinagar, said. Further, traffic congestion has increased in business centers, with the government deploying extra staff to handle the traffic. “We request people to adhere to the traffic rules so that movement remains smooth in this festive season,” said a traffic department official—(KNO)
